.horizontal {
	border: 0;
	margin: 0;
	display: inline;
	padding: 0;
}

.horizontal table {
	display: inline;
	margin: 0;
	padding: 0;
	border: 0;
}

.horizontal td {
	padding: 0;
	margin: 0;
	border: 0;
	behavior:url("css/IEFixes.htc");
}

.horizontal ul {
        list-style-type: none;
	padding: 0;
	margin: 0;
	border: 0;
}

.horizontal li {
	background-color: transparent;
	padding: 0;
	margin: 0;
	border: 0;
	behavior:url("css/IEFixes.htc");
}

.horizontal img {
	padding: 0;
	margin: 0;
	border: 0;
}

.horizontal a img {
	border: 0;
}

.horizontal li ul li {
	behavior:url("css/IEFixes.htc");
}
	

.horizontal td:hover ul, div.horizontal td.hover ul {
	visibility: visible;
	background-color: #000000;
}

.flyoutlower ul {
	position: absolute;
	visibility: hidden;
	width: 250 px;
}

.flyoutlower li {
	background-color: #516F8F;
	color: #FFFFFF;
	font-size: 10px;
	padding: 3px;
}

.horizontal a:link {
	color: #ffffff;
	text-decoration: none;
}

.horizontal a:visited {
	color: #ffffff;
	text-decoration: none;
}

.horizontal a:hover {
	color: #ffffff;
	text-decoration: underline;
}
